Subject: [PATCH 2/3] usb: host: st-hcd: Add st-hcd devicetree bindings documentation.

This patch documents the device tree documentation required for
the ST HCD controller found in STMicroelectronics SoCs.

+ST HCD (Host Controller Driver) for USB 2.0 and 1.1
+
+The device node has the following properties.
+
+Required properties:
+ - compatible		: must be "st,usb-300x"
+ - reg			: physical base addresses of the controller and length of memory mapped
+			  region
+ - reg-names		: names associated to the reg defines above, should be "ehci" and "ohci"
+ - interrupts		: interrupt numbers to the cpu
+ - interrupt-names	: should be "ehci" and "ohci"
+
+ - pinctrl-names	: a pinctrl state named "default" must be defined
+-  pinctrl-0		: phandle referencing pin configuration of the USB controller
+See: Documentation/devicetree/bindings/pinctrl/pinctrl-binding.txt
+
+ - clocks		: phandle list of usb clocks.
+ - clock-names		: should be "ic" for interconnect clock and "ohci" for the 48MHz clock
+See: Documentation/devicetree/bindings/clock/clock-bindings.txt
+
+ - resets		: phandle to the powerdown and reset controller for the USB IP
+ - reset-names		: should be "power" and "softreset".
+See: Documentation/devicetree/bindings/reset/st,sti-powerdown.txt
+See: Documentation/devicetree/bindings/reset/reset.txt
+
+Example:
+
+usb0: usb@...00000 {
+	compatible	= "st,usb-300x";
+	reg		= <0xfe1ffc00 0x100>,
+			  <0xfe1ffe00 0x100>;
+	reg-names	= "ohci", "ehci";
+
+	interrupts	=  <GIC_SPI 148 IRQ_TYPE_NONE>,
+			   <GIC_SPI 149 IRQ_TYPE_NONE>;
+	interrupt-names	= "ehci","ohci";
+	pinctrl-names	= "default";
+	pinctrl-0	= <&pinctrl_usb0>;
+	clocks		= <&clk_s_a1_ls CLK_ICN_IF_2>,
+			  <&clockgen_b0 0>;
+	clock-names	= "ic", "ohci";
+
+	resets		= <&powerdown STIH416_USB0_POWERDOWN>,
+			  <&softreset STIH416_USB0_SOFTRESET>;
+	reset-names	= "power", "softreset";
+
+	phys = <&usb2_phy>;
+	phy-names = "usb2-phy";
+};
